Potential nest entry point sent to city defense headquarters. . .
Hundreds of ants are exiting out the nest every minute and moving to the left, deeper into the Pike, likely drawn by the bait set up by the defenders. So how the fuck do I get in?
Since none of the ants appear to be able to see, hear or smell me from this distance, I drop all mana, including my construct armor. I am almost certainly going to need all my mana no matter what I do to get in there. A preliminary op plan is forming in my mind but I’ll need to conduct a test first. I work my way back to where I met the warrior ant and search around for the correct circumstances. Another few minutes later after bypassing larger groups of ants, I find a smaller gathering and hide behind the stone wall of a restaurant called Margaretta’s Pizza, Pasta and Subs. I swap out my armor for my favorite, Covert Infiltrator set, lean around the side, line up a shot with my rifle and strike one of the ants in the antenna. Jo informed me that was determined to be a weakness of these workers. Immediately after firing, I [Inventory] the rifle and merge with the building’s shadow flat on the ground.
The ant I struck stumbles, screeches and all three begin firing projectiles towards my location. None of them target the shadow I am hiding in; test one complete. Remaining in the shadows, I slide forward along the wall of the building, moving from the shadow of a window eave to an awning over the entrance and stop there, about halfway to the ants. None of the ants change their targets to my shadow. I continue my way forward, melding from shadow to shadow until I am right above them, in the shadow of the large model of a triangular pizza slice. None of the ants notice; test two complete. I follow another two shadows and eventually merge with one of the flaming ants’s shadows. They still don’t notice me. Test three complete.
Advertisement
Alright, last one. I return to the pizza slice shadow, because pizza, and drop a darkness field so all three are surrounded with 10 meters to spare. The ants stop firing their needles and [Mana Sight] tells me they begin to wander aimlessly. One even bumps into a wall but just keeps moving as if it doesn’t notice. If the orcs freak the fuck out in darkness, these ants are the opposite and become passive and lethargic. Wait a minute. The black fire isn’t showing in my mana sight any more. Well that is unexpected. I keep watching and see no change. Releasing the darkness field I am blown away by what I see after it finally clears. Thanks to darkness sludge, it takes twice as long to clear as before I received my subclass. The flaming spikes on the ants are gone. These look like normal dark brown infused ants.
[Shitballs on a dragon. Are you seeing this, Jo?]
That is quite an unexpected and fascinating side effect. I have no idea how that could-
Suddenly the ants start shuddering and shaking. They then screech and black spikes begin exiting from their bodies. After a moment the spikes are back to the normal size and burst into black flames.
[Well. . . that just happened.]
I see. Ants communicate through airborne pheromones, sounds and touch. It is possible the darkness temporarily disabled a corrupting signal and when that disruption ended they became corrupted again. . .
I excitedly think, [Jo, this is a huge opportunity!]
I use [Mana Sight] and see exactly what I expect based on previous observations: the brown earth of the ants with black spikes and flames absorbing all the nearby mana particles. Similar to the possessed troll king’s green flames, but to a much lesser degree. Keeping [Mana Sight] active, I drop another darkness field and watch for change. Over the period of between four and five seconds, the flames dim and the spikes fade away, likely to ash although I cannot see for sure in [Mana Sight]. The ants show no further sign of corruption, showing only their confused glowing brown forms. I release the darkness field and watch closely. The moment the suppression of the darkness fades, a small black cloud forms as a swirl near its head fades into view and spreads to its middle thorax and then to the rest of it, legs included. Only its antennae appear uncorrupted. Shortly the black spikes grow and black flames reappear. What is interesting is the black cloud inside of the ant I am examining is gone. All I see is the absorption of mana into the black flames.
Advertisement
[You seeing this?]
Affirmative. . .
[Can we detect it through that cloud of corruption or perhaps the mana absorption? And where does the mana go?]
Unknown at this time. But it could be a possible manner in which to identify corrupted individuals, which I imagine was your goal from the beginning of this exercise. . .
I nod and decide to conduct the experiment again. This time when the darkness fades I keep an eye on the mana particles around an ant, which I name Bob. I pick Bob for no particular reason other than he is the closest. When he isn’t a flaming death monster, I think he’s kinda cute in a goofy run into buildings sort of way.
Anyway, as soon as the darkness cloud dissipates I watch closely for how the cloud forms and what happens to it. Something completely new and unexpected happens this time though. When the ants are shuddering and screeching the cloud seems to flicker and the ants screen a little louder. Then the cloud flashes and all three ants burst apart, ant flesh and pieces of carapace flying everywhere. Yuck.
There appears to be a maximum the worker ant body can withstand this corruption. . .
[What gave you that idea?]
I let out a sigh, exit the shadow and wander around finding another group.
***
40 minutes later, I think I may have figured it out.
[So let’s review. The worker ants can tolerate it no more than four times, most only three. The corruption, which I see as a swirl of black - not particles but an actual cloud - melds with the brown mana of the ant and creates external paths for the mana to be absorbed, thus the spikes. About 15% of the mana is absorbed back into the ant, enhancing its earth affinity, while the other 85% gets absorbed into the fire and vanishes into who knows where - probably back to the multi-vocal “masters” from our lovely troll king. Ants communicate through three senses which are disabled by darkness and when those are disabled the corruption can no longer function meaning it requires constant reinforcement to stay active. Did I miss anything?]
That is an excellent summary. Shall I pass the report to Shield?. . .
[Absolutely. This was only workers though. We don’t know if the same would be true for the warrior ants or anything besides ants.]
Sent. Try not to get killed figuring it out. . .
I begin a silent jog towards the nest entry tunnel.
[You know I was about to say I haven’t died yet, but I suppose that technically isn’t true. So yeah, keep reminding me not to die. Ummm. . . again.] I hear a deep sigh.
